What is the scope of the right to self-determination of indigenous peoples in Costa Rica?
The right to self-determination of indigenous peoples in Costa Rica implies their right to freely determine their political, economic, social and cultural condition. Respect for their autonomy, their forms of organization and government, as well as the protection of their lands, territories and natural resources, are promoted.
What are the penalties for illegal exercise of the profession in Brazil?
Brazil The illegal exercise of the profession in Brazil refers to the practice of a professional activity without the proper authorization, registration or license required by law. The penalties for illegal exercise of the profession may vary depending on the severity of the crime and the specific legislation of each profession. Sanctions may include fines, bans from practicing the profession and disciplinary measures.

What is the procedure for processing an appeal for unconstitutionality in the Dominican Republic?
The appeal of unconstitutionality in the Dominican Republic is used to challenge the constitutionality of a law or government act. The process involves filing a lawsuit before the Constitutional Court, arguing the reasons for unconstitutionality. The Court will evaluate the claim and issue a decision on the validity of the challenged law or act.
